Hearty beef brisket & vegetable soup
F. Whitlock & Sons Brazen Beef Brisket Soup - Quite a nice canned soup with chunky vegetables and plenty of beef brisket. It has a tomato/herb flavour with a touch of spice.
Very flavoursome and definitely not a bland boring soup.

Ok for a quick meal
The F. Whitlock & Sons Brazen Beef Brisket Soup is hearty and flavourful but lacks the depth you’d expect from brisket. While the beef is tender, the broth is slightly salty, and the overall taste is just okay. Decent for a quick meal but doesn’t quite stand out.
